STEP INTO THE 'GAMEZONE'
Young people are being invited to during the summer weather to step into the ‘Games Zone’ of the CyberCentre in Carnegie Library, Main Street in Ayr and play some great FREE games. If the sun is beating down and you want some shade, or if it is raining and you want something exciting to do the ‘Games Zone’ has it all, Xbox, Playstation 2 and much more. Two players can use each game machine, which is attached to a 26” LCD television screen, with steering wheels and headphones also available. The library is currently looking for ideas on the type of games that could be introduced in the library and is seeking the views of young people. Anyone who comes in and plays the games will have the chance to place their idea, along with their name into an “Xbox and Playstation 2 New Games Wish List”. The closing date for leaving ideas is 1 September 2006, one lucky person will have their name randomly drawn from all those who leave their ideas and will win a game A valid South Ayrshire Library card or Young Scot card is required to be produced and shown to staff before using the games machines. Advance booking facilities are available either by logging onto www.south-ayrshire.gov.uk/libraries or by telephoning 01292 618492 or 01292 286385.
